This Draft Loan Agreement is a simple and illustrative format for an interest-free personal loan between two individuals. It may be used where money is advanced based on mutual trust, such as between friends, relatives, or acquaintances. The draft records the basic terms relating to the loan amount, duration, repayment, and understanding between the lender and the borrower. Parties are advised to modify the draft as per their specific requirements and to seek legal advice before execution.

SECURITY & CHEQUE CLAUSE (NI ACT COMPLIANCE)
- Security Cheque
In discharge of the above liability, the Borrower has issued the following cheque(s) in favour of the Lender:
Cheque No. __________
Date: __________
Amount: Rs. __________
Drawn on: __________________ Bank
The Borrower admits that the said cheque(s) have been issued towards legally enforceable debt/liability.
- Dishonour of Cheque
In the event of dishonour of the said cheque(s), the Borrower shall be liable for action under Section 138 of the Negotiable Instruments Act, 1881, in addition to civil remedies available to the Lender.
DEFAULT & REMEDIES
- Event of Default
The Borrower shall be deemed in default if:
- fails to repay the loan within the agreed period; or
- the security cheque is dishonoured; or
- breaches any term of this Agreement.
- Legal Remedies
Upon default, the Lender shall be entitled to:
- demand immediate repayment of the entire outstanding amount;
- initiate civil and/or criminal proceedings, including under NI Act;
- recover legal expenses and costs from the Borrower.
ARBITRATION & JURISDICTION
- Arbitration
Any dispute arising out of or in connection with this Agreement shall be referred to sole arbitration, to be conducted in accordance with the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996.
Seat and venue of arbitration shall be __________.
- Governing Law & Jurisdiction
This Agreement shall be governed by the laws of India, and subject to arbitration, courts at __________ shall have jurisdiction.
